Kylian Mbappe reaches 100 appearances for Real Madrid
Kylian Mbappe celebrated a significant milestone during Real Madrid’s 1-1 draw with Real Betis, marking his 100th appearance for the Spanish giants.
The French forward achieved this landmark in just his second season at the Bernabeu, demonstrating his importance to the team since arriving in summer 2024.
Mbappe made his competitive debut for Real Madrid in the 2024 UEFA Super Cup final against Atalanta on August 14, 2024, where he scored the second goal in a 2-0 victory, securing the club’s record sixth title in the competition. Since that memorable debut, the 27-year-old has been a prolific scorer, netting an impressive 85 goals across all competitions while helping Madrid secure 66 victories.
His century of appearances includes 62 La Liga matches, 25 Champions League fixtures, five Spanish Cup games, four Club World Cup encounters, three Spanish Super Cup matches, and one UEFA Super Cup appearance. This season alone has been particularly productive, with Mbappe featuring in 41 matches and contributing 41 goals alongside five assists.
The striker’s remarkable scoring rate places him among the most efficient forwards in European football, averaging nearly a goal per game during his Madrid career.
